Output 3c5cef5da0b622c4b3925168c27888c31e37dd3132c53b8394c453f879d05b87:0

value
24490600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72df450716df78e62e9392d48ac231ca80f5bf8c OP_EQUAL
address
3CAQRTa6aM2c95hjgHMRRVwpnCJEDY3gC9
transaction
3c5cef5da0b622c4b3925168c27888c31e37dd3132c53b8394c453f879d05b87
confirmations
271303
spent
true